  • Apple Officially Announces Apple One Bundles

    During today’s Apple event, the company announced Apple One, a plan to combine Apple’s subscription services in one simple plan. Apple One includes Apple Music, Apple TV+, Apple Arcade, Apple News, Apple Fitness, and iCloud in a single subscription. “Apple One makes enjoying Apple subscription services easier than ever, including Apple Music, Apple TV+, Apple…

    Disney+ Launches in Eight More European Countries

    Disney announced today that Disney+ has launched in eight more countries, expanding the streaming service’s global footprint to Belgium, Portugal, Sweden, Finland, Norway, Denmark, Luxembourg, and Iceland. Here are the prices for each of the countries: €6.99/€69.99 in Portugal, Belgium, Finland, Iceland, and Luxembourg 69 NOK/689 NOK in Norway 69 SEK/689 in Sweden 59 DKK/589…

    Disney+ On Track to Surpass Hulu in Viewers by 2024

    Digital data and research company eMarketer estimates that Disney+ will top its sister service Hulu in viewer numbers by 2024. The research shows that, while Netflix is still on top with 168.9 million viewers, Disney+, which launched in November 2019, is on track to have 72.4 million viewers this year.
